The CTAN 20 version of LaTeXPiX is available. Changes are:
* When opening or merging files when canvas is zoomed in, the drawing was
incorrectly loaded. Bug reported by Robert Rutten.
* When no objects are selected, dragging the when holding the left mouse
button enables selecting of multiple objects. Idea came from Robert Rutten.
* Added more information and exception handling when the Windows registry
cannot be read/written. Thanks to Keith Mellinger for testing.
* Renamed "Generate Registration Request Number" to "Register" and changed
register procedure to name and key only (no registry file will be sent
anymore).
* Stripped ebb.exe from the style installer.
* Version 1.1 of latexpix.sty now in the style installer (changed legal
information).
* Object resizing with fixed aspect ratio went had a bug.
* Undo data now created when moving or resizing objects. Also the program
could crash when an object is selected and undone.
* Browsing through object shortcut key moved from CTRL+5 to CTRL+TAB.
